Why use this integration?

  • Integration of Somfy RTS controller’s to the shades service with scene builds enabled.
        • Blinds/curtains present in the pro app in the Shades service as a dimmer slider – 0-33% will trigger down and the slider will then snap to 0% – 34-66% will trigger stop and the slider will then snap to 50% – 67-100% will trigger open and the slider will then snap to 100%.
  • Automatically restart when some issue happened
  • Automatic state updates from Somfy to Savant after a reboot or power outage
  • Automatic driver updates – Anytime we release an update to the driver your customer’s host will receive it and update between the hours of 2am-5am

Somfy Driver Connection Options

  • Global Cache FLEX-IP-P-AU iTach Flex IP with PoE and FLC-SL-485 Flex Link Serial Cable (RS485) connected to a somfy RTS controller.
            • Savant RS232 ports with RS485 adapters cannot be used with this integration, it simply will not work.
            • The Global Cache unit should have a fixed IP and if using unifi network equipment we recommend a reservation as well.
            • RS485 bus termination practices should be followed*
                  • 120ohm resistors at either end of the bus line
                  • No more than two RS485 lines from the GC unit.
                  • The integration supports an unlimited number of Somfy RTS controllers connected.
            • Update GC firmware to version 710-3000-21 or newer**

Ensure the following settings are set in the global cache unit:

Global Cache Settings – Navigate to the global cache settings via it’s IP using a web browser. Ensure all the settings match these settings:

Cable Type: RS485 (THIS SHOULD AUTO DETECT WHEN YOU HAVE THE RS485 CABLE CONNECTED – IF IT DOES NOT AUTO DETECT YOUR UNIT IS FAULTY. WE HAVE SEEN THIS ON RARE OCCASIONS)

Baud Rate: 4800

Flow Control: None

Duplex: Half

Parity: Odd

Data Bits: 8

Stop Bits: 1

Gender Change: False

Authentication

As soon as the driver begins to run it will attempt to authenticate with neat’s server – If authentication fails and/or a licence has not been purchased (Plus processed – neat’s admin needs to confirm the order) the system will become unresponsive to Somfy commands after 24 Hours.

Anytime the host is restarted it will need to authenticate with neat’s server within 24 hours otherwise Somfy commands will become unresponsive.

The driver will try to call the neat server every 5 minutes to check for an available update.
